You've likely seen the phrase “energy transition” pop up everywhere lately.

At its core, the energy transition is the worldwide shift from fossil-fuel-based energy sources to renewable alternatives such as sun-powered, air-turbine, water-generated, biomass, hydrogen from renewables, and geothermal energy. But this overhaul is more than just trading coal for sun — it's a complete reengineering of how we fuel our entire world.

New Technologies in the Clean Era

Sunlight and wind power headline the change, but they’re just part of the story. Energy containment systems like lithium-ion cells help smooth out supply in a renewable-heavy grid.

Clean hydrogen is emerging fast — particularly for hard-to-electrify industries such as industrial production. Although early-stage, it promises a game-changing solution for decarbonised power.
